Next-Generation Sequencing Market by Product Type (Consumables, Platforms, Bioinformatics), Technology (SBS, Nanopore), Workflow (Sequencing, Data Analysis), Services, Application (Drug Discovery, Diagnostic, Agriculture) - Global Forecast to 2029
The global next-generation sequencing market, valued at US$12.13 billion in 2023, stood at US$12.65 billion in 2024 and is projected to advance at a resilient CAGR of 13.2% from 2024 to 2029, culminating in a forecasted valuation of US$23.55 billion by the end of the period. The primary growth drivers of the next-generation sequencing market are the surge in the rising demand for precision medicine in identifying genetic mutations and biomarkers, enabling targeted therapies and advancing precision medicine initiatives globally.

European NGS Services Market by Technology (SBS, SBL, SMRT, Pyrosequencing), Application (Exome Sequencing, CHIP-Seq), End User (Pharmaceutical Companies, Hospital), Disease [Oncology (Prostate, Lung, & Breast Cancer), Rare Diseases) - Forecast to 2020
The NGS services market in Europe is expected to reach USD 1,152 Million by 2020 from USD 444 Million in 2015, at a CAGR of 21% from 2015 to 2020. Factors such as rising preference of NGS over other platforms; rapid and cost-efficient sequencing; rising prevalence of inherited diseases; application of genomics in drug discovery; growing prevalence of cancer and other malignant diseases; and partnerships among companies, R&D centers, and universities are expected to drive market growth. However, high dependence on grants for R&D, lack of analytics, and stringent reimbursement policies are likely to restrict the growth of this market to a certain extent.
